The phrase "identifying attributes" is correct and usable in written English.
It is typically used to describe specific characteristics or traits that help distinguish a person, object, or idea from others. Example: "As a detective, it is crucial to pay attention to small details, such as identifying attributes, in order to accurately identify suspects."
